    Thanks silver*...I have seen that before and it applies here in this regard. Again this guy that claims to be all that..is no where to be found among the Cherokee or Lakota..and they frown against this type of thing.

    Now here in North Carolina where I live...The Cherokee tribes hold a special event for everybody to attend...I believe Linda our member here as been there for the event and it was very powerful. But the very sacred ceremonies and teachings remain among the elders and tribe members as sacred and they do not project it out there for others to abuse or twist in meaning.

    Most Native Americans also have a huge problem with new agers for stealing their teachings and profiting form them. No secret there either. Little Grandmother is at the top of their list as one of those.
